Program notes

Violin virtuoso Renaud Capuçon and piano star Bertrand Chamayou join François-Xavier Roth and his acclaimed period-instrument ensemble Les Siècles to take us around the world with the music of Camille Saint-Saëns!

The French master's music—including some famous works and some gems you may not have heard before—is on glorious, globe-trotting display here. In addition to music from the opera Le Timbre d'argent, which Les Siècles revived in 2017 over a century after its last performance, we hear the composer's evocations of Africa in the piano fantasia Africa and "Egyptian" Piano Concerto with Chamayou, take a tour of Greek mythology in symphonic poems Phaeton and The Youth of Hercules, marvel at the beloved violin show­piece Introduction and Rondo capriccioso with Capuçon, and finish in deliciously sinister territory with the diabolical Danse macabre
